tbh as a way of limiting magic I'm much more interested in risk management than resource management
not how much can you do before you run out of steam
but how far can you push it before it blows up in your face
I think this first occurred to me reading the Shadowdark quickstart a while back
(I don't mean to bash the system, Shadowdark seems well-liked and successful, it's just not to my tastes)
it has an alright magic system, largely roll-to-cast, you can keep casting a spell until you fail to cast that spell, miscast on a natural 1
I had problems with this, at least from my perspective
miscasts are fine, good even, but only happening on a natural 1, that's a flat 5% chance at all times
and IMO this is kinda dull
I won't spell failure to vary based on the situation, how many times has the spellcaster cast today, how many times has a spellcaster cast in this scene, has the spellcaster had a spell failure recently, are there any antimagic entities or objects present, is there something big and magical going on, what is the general health of the caster, and so on

The Magus, by momatoes.
The Magus is a solo journaling tabletop RPG that takes you on a sweeping journey for power, ambition, and arcane mastery, at great personal and interpersonal cost.
As a journaling game, you will roll dice, track stats, create spells, and write  imaginary experiences from the perspective of your character: a wizard, newly embarking on their quest for power, their head filled with grand visions of mastery.
This RPG is crunchy. You will use several polyhedral dice to manage four traits: Focus, Power, Control, and Scars, which shape how the protagonist overcomes  challenges and meets their denouement after seven, fateful events. 
This game is also beautiful. It has a number of stunning images used as backdrop against the text of the game, illuminating each part of your character sheet before diving into the meat of the game. The game itself pits your character between two choices: increasing the bonds between them and their loved ones, or sacrificing those opportunities to gain in power. You’ll roll a number of dice equal to your power in order to learn more spells, which are created using a combination of prompts and your own imagination.
Miscast, by Paradox Press Games.
You are undergoing training to become the successor of a Master Conjurer, but the only problem is that the Master Conjurer has a major Dragon's Dust addiction and spends most of their days higher than the mountains of Mar' Hollok. This leaves you solely responsible for your own training while also having to conjure up the creatures that eager customers come to your Master’s shop seeking. Long story short, you miscast spells a lot and end up conjuring a wide assortment of weird and fantastical monsters.
This game can be played solo, or it can be played in a group. You are using a deck of cards and a d6 to conjure different kinds of creatures; unfortunately, you’re only an apprentice, so the creatures don’t always come out right. You’ll use the cards from the different suits to determine the physical aspects of the monster, while you’ll use the d6 to determine how big the monster is, the monster’s nature, and what further Abnormalities it might be suffering. A game for funny random creatures, great for getting your creative juices going!
Sigils in the Dark, by Kurt Potts.
You have a need, a deep burning needthat drives you. Is it love, regret, desire?
The darkness whispers, “I can help you…”Minutes turn to hours as you try to focuson the voice. Symbols, shapes, swirl in thedarkness at the edge of your perception.If only you could grasp them, your needs would be met and more.
Sigils in the Dark is a journaling game and GM supplement. The goal of the game is to create an evil mage’s spellbook. You’ll take up the role of this wizard with a desperate need, in search of arcane power to get what they want. They will try to understand dark sigils just outside their perception by randomly generating spells and adding liner notes to their grimoire. In the end, you’ll have an in-game artifact that you can pass on to players and hopefully know a little more about what your evil mage has sacrificed to get where they are.
Using random roll tables, you’ll slowly create an artifact and a number of spells invented by a dark wizard. Each spell will also have a cost, and the wizard may choose to write notes that betray their own personality as they edit the spell the way an expert baker edits a recipe book.
 This is great for slow character creation, as you try to figure out the motives and goals of a wizard character, and can also put together pieces of their life before they meet anyone else.
The Final Undertaking, by kay w.
Tonight you will prepare the body. You will hang the heavy black curtain, and you will put out the call in the town paper.  Tomorrow night, when the sun sets, the chosen mourner will arrive, with their matter to discuss. You will sit with the body on one side, coaxing the soul back to the body, and the mourner will sit on the other.  The final undertaking will begin.
THE FINAL UNDERTAKING is a one player journaling game about grief, resolution, necromancy, and a town. It uses a d4, a tarot deck, and pen and paper to tell a story about an undertaker, who works in a town to prepare bodies for burial, briefly brings the spirit back to the body, and then facilitates a conversation between a single mourner and the deceased about their unresolved business.
In this game, you will use the tarot cards to form a spread that tells the bones of a story -- the deceased, the object they are being buried with, the mourner here to visit them, and the unresolved business between them. From your spread, you will be able to construct small narratives and write them down as journal entries. 
This is a lovingly written and designed game about putting the dead to rest. You will write journal entries from the point of view of an Undertaker, someone who is responsible for facilitating one last conversation between the spirit of the deceased and their mourner. You will play through 3 phases, which involve determining how well you knew the deceased, the situation at death, and what needs to be resolved before they can pass on to their final rest.The book comes with an oracle of Solemnities, which give you prompts to help you interpret each spread. You can play through the three phases as many times as you like, journaling for each one.
Grimoire, by Anna Landin.
Sparks of magic dance on your palms, flow like rivers through the world around you, and you can weave them into something powerful. You are a witch - and just as a tailor draws their patterns out, and cooks will write their well-kept secret recipes down, so you, too, will bind your spells in ink and paper and make for yourself a grimoire - a spellbook in which to keep your knowledge.
Grimoire is a roleplaying game for one person, played with a deck of regular playing cards with the jokers taken out, a six-sided die, and something to write your spells down with. The latter can be a blank notebook or a sketchbook, or one of the templates provided with these rules. Over the course of the game, you will make a spellbook of your own, a collection of spells you craft out of magic power and components available to you.
If you desire a character that’s a bit less evil wizard and a bit more homebrew witch, Grimoire is another great way to put together a spell book using randomly generated prompts and whatever components your witch has available.
